Output 60abc637b25251f7ccbc5fb6e93a193c18f39c17bce16fb72d605b409029b66d:30

value
1082896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9688905163ea983d702ab229ca99c34eab8b9ffa OP_EQUAL
address
3FQxsw6PJM58EVnE6pz94JDU2R5eXfmHfZ
transaction
60abc637b25251f7ccbc5fb6e93a193c18f39c17bce16fb72d605b409029b66d
spent
true